Temperature not always showing next to icon

Bug #767123 reported by Cas
26
This bug affects 5 people
Affects Status Importance Assigned to Milestone
Weather Indicator
Fix Released
Medium
Vadim Rutkovsky

Bug Description

I noticed this happened when it was foggy icon being displayed. I cannot reproduce it but restarting the applet seems to fix it.

Version: 11.04.10 'Cloudy'
OS: Natty Beta

Revision history for this message
Vadim Rutkovsky (roignac) wrote :

Could you please attach the screenshot and the logs from ~/.cache/indicator-weather.log, when this will be reproducible?
Does this happen constantly? Does the temperature being displayed in several seconds?

Changed in weather-indicator:
status: New → Incomplete
Revision history for this message
Cas (calumlind) wrote :

After some investigation I found it occurs after resuming from standby and the only way to fix it is to restart the applet.

Revision history for this message
Cas (calumlind) wrote :
Revision history for this message
Cas (calumlind) wrote :
Revision history for this message
Vadim Rutkovsky (roignac) wrote :

It seems, that for some reason CouchDB cannot read settings and assumes, that temp should not be displayed

Changed in weather-indicator:
assignee: nobody → Vadim Rutkovsky (roignac)
importance: Undecided → Medium
milestone: none → 11.04.23
status: Incomplete → Confirmed
Revision history for this message
Vadim Rutkovsky (roignac) wrote :

Committed a probable fix, hope this helps. If this is still reproducible, please change bug status to New and attach new logs here

Changed in weather-indicator:
status: Confirmed → Fix Committed
Changed in weather-indicator:
status: Fix Committed → Fix Released
Revision history for this message
Cas (calumlind) wrote :

It does not appear to have fixed it, I also noticed it stops refreshing. I have attached new logs to see if that helps.

Cas (calumlind)
Changed in weather-indicator:
status: Fix Released → New
Revision history for this message
Vadim Rutkovsky (roignac) wrote :

A new version with correct exception logging has been released today - 11.05.01. Please, attach a new indicator-weather.log after encountering the issue in new version

Changed in weather-indicator:
status: New → Incomplete
Revision history for this message
Cas (calumlind) wrote :
Changed in weather-indicator:
status: Incomplete → Confirmed
milestone: 11.04.24 → none
Revision history for this message
Vadim Rutkovsky (roignac) wrote :

It seems, that DesktopCouch cannot start. Could you please try removing and reinstalling desktopcouch packages?

Revision history for this message
Cas (calumlind) wrote :

Still does not work. These are the steps I took:

  sudo apt-get purge desktopcouch indicator-weather

  indicator-weather

*Standby*
*Resume*
(The temp is now missing and refresh stops working)

  pgrep -fl desktopcouch
  2360 /usr/bin/python /usr/lib/desktopcouch/desktopcouch-service
  2520 /usr/bin/python /usr/lib/desktopcouch/desktopcouch-service
  2521 desktopcouch-se

  pkill -f indicator-weather

  indicator-weather

  pgrep -fl desktopcouch
  2360 /usr/bin/python /usr/lib/desktopcouch/desktopcouch-service
  2520 /usr/bin/python /usr/lib/desktopcouch/desktopcouch-service
  2521 desktopcouch-se

I have also noticed that I cannot quit the indicator from the indicator menu after resuming so have to use pkill.

Revision history for this message
Cas (calumlind) wrote :

Ok I found the issue is something to do with desktopcouch. I will investigate other desktopcouch bugs to see if they relate.

Before standby:
  pgrep -fl desktop
  3322 /bin/sh -e /usr/bin/couchdb <snipped>
  3329 /bin/sh -e /usr/bin/couchdb <snipped>
  3330 /usr/lib/erlang/erts-5.7.4/bin/beam.smp <snipped>
  8198 /usr/bin/python /usr/lib/desktopcouch/desktopcouch-service
  8212 /usr/bin/python /usr/lib/desktopcouch/desktopcouch-service
  8213 desktopcouch-se

After standby:
  pgrep -fl desktop
  8198 /usr/bin/python /usr/lib/desktopcouch/desktopcouch-service
  8212 /usr/bin/python /usr/lib/desktopcouch/desktopcouch-service
  8213 desktopcouch-se

Changed in weather-indicator:
milestone: none → 11.05.31
status: Confirmed → Fix Released
Revision history for this message
Cas (calumlind) wrote :

Thanks, working perfectly for me now :D

Revision history for this message
JC (nothingness) wrote :

After the latest update, the temperature is not showing next to the icon when I log in.
Ubuntu 11.04 64bit
Weather Indicator 11.05.31 'Cloudy 8'

Revision history for this message
Vadim Rutkovsky (roignac) wrote :

After migration to dconf all the settings were not migrated (in order to drop desktopcouch dependencies and update location data due to several bugs). As temperature is not being shown be default, please check 'Show temperature' checkbox in Preferences

Revision history for this message
John Kuang (xiphosurus) wrote :

Even after checking "Show temperature", upon rebooting, the temperature is missing again. Seems like the "Show temperature" checkbox became unchecked by itself by rebooting. I am using Weather Indicator 11.05.31 'Cloudy 8'.

Revision history for this message
Vadim Rutkovsky (roignac) wrote :

This issue is submitted as bug #791398

Revision history for this message
Bernard Decock (decockbernard) wrote :

Weather Indicator 11.05.31 'Cloudy 8': Setting preference "Show temperature near indicator" doens't work (Ubuntu 11.10 - classic gnome)

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Duplicates of this bug

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.